+- name: 2d.canvas.context.exists
+ desc: The 2D context is implemented
+ code: |
+ @assert canvas.getContext('2d') !== null;
+
+- name: 2d.canvas.context.invalid.args
+ desc: Calling getContext with invalid arguments.
+ code: |
+ @assert canvas.getContext('') === null;
+ @assert canvas.getContext('2d#') === null;
+ @assert canvas.getContext('This is clearly not a valid context name.') === null;
+ @assert canvas.getContext('2d\0') === null;
+ @assert canvas.getContext('2\uFF44') === null;
+ @assert canvas.getContext('2D') === null;
+ @assert throws TypeError canvas.getContext();
+ @assert canvas.getContext('null') === null;
+ @assert canvas.getContext('undefined') === null;
+
+- name: 2d.canvas.context.extraargs.create
+ desc: The 2D context doesn't throw with extra getContext arguments (new context)
+ code: |
+ @assert document.createElement("canvas").getContext('2d', false, {}, [], 1, "2") !== null;
+ @assert document.createElement("canvas").getContext('2d', 123) !== null;
+ @assert document.createElement("canvas").getContext('2d', "test") !== null;
+ @assert document.createElement("canvas").getContext('2d', undefined) !== null;
+ @assert document.createElement("canvas").getContext('2d', null) !== null;
+ @assert document.createElement("canvas").getContext('2d', Symbol.hasInstance) !== null;
+
+- name: 2d.canvas.context.extraargs.cache
+ desc: The 2D context doesn't throw with extra getContext arguments (cached)
+ code: |
+ @assert canvas.getContext('2d', false, {}, [], 1, "2") !== null;
+ @assert canvas.getContext('2d', 123) !== null;
+ @assert canvas.getContext('2d', "test") !== null;
+ @assert canvas.getContext('2d', undefined) !== null;
+ @assert canvas.getContext('2d', null) !== null;
+ @assert canvas.getContext('2d', Symbol.hasInstance) !== null;
